With regards to being inbounds or being outa bounds, the rules do not differentiate between one foot or more feet.

A player is where the player is until that player is somewhere else.
And, the player is somewhere else when that player is touching somewhere else.

Yes, 4.35.2c says it simply.

Don't over-think this thing, just keep it simple.
There is nothing tricky here.
